Galaxy Tab Active is a little bit better than Galaxy Note 10.1, having a 67 score against 66.3. Although Galaxy Tab Active is just a little thicker than the Galaxy Note 10.1, it's lighter and extremely newer. Both tablets in this comparison include the same Android 4.4 OS (operating system). The Samsung Galaxy Tab Active counts with a bit superior processing unit than Galaxy Note 10.1, because although it has 512 MB lesser RAM, and they both have 4 CPU cores, the Samsung Galaxy Tab Active also counts with an extra graphics processing unit.
Samsung Galaxy Tab Active has a much better display than Galaxy Note 10.1, because although it has a really smaller screen, and they both have the same 1280 x 800 pixels resolution, the Samsung Galaxy Tab Active also counts with a greater quantity of pixels per inch in the screen. Samsung Galaxy Note 10.1 has a much greater memory for applications and games than Samsung Galaxy Tab Active, because although it has a SD memory slot that admits up to 32 GB against 64 GB, it also counts with 64 GB internal memory capacity.
The Samsung Galaxy Note 10.1 has a much longer battery life than Galaxy Tab Active, because it has 7000mAh of battery capacity. The Galaxy Tab Active takes better photos and videos than Galaxy Note 10.1, although it has a much lower 3.1 MP resolution back camera and a worse (HD) video resolution.
Although Galaxy Tab Active is a better device, it costs more than Galaxy Note 10.1, and it doesn't have such a good price and quality relation as the Galaxy Note 10.1. So if you want that extra specs and features, you can buy the Galaxy Tab Active, else you can save a couple dollars and buy the Galaxy Note 10.1, resigning some features and specifications.
